Visit the most visited natural attraction in New Zealand on this half day afternoon tour perfect for those with a tight schedule!

The Huka Falls are the largest falls on the Waikato River, near Taupo on New Zealand's North Island. The Waikato river is one of New Zealand's longest rivers and it drains Lake Taupo - the largest freshwater lake in all of Australasia.
